NEW: Ottawa police procuring equipment for possible 'Freedom Convoy' reboot: chief ottnews FreedomConvoy
"We will be ready," Chief Eric Stubbs told CTV News on Monday. "The ultimate goal of all this planning and preparing is to ensure that what happened last year doesn't happen this year."
Last month, James Bauder, the founder of the Canada Unity group and one of the original organizers of the protests,Bauder posted on Facebook calling for a 'Freedom Convoy 2.0' Feb. 17 to 21 in Ottawa, calling it an "olive branch edition" that would depart Ottawa on Feb. 22. The Ottawa police handling of the convoy occupation was a central theme of the public order emergency commission this fall, which examined the federal government's invocation of the Emergencies Act to end the protest. The police force's preparation, intelligence gathering and decision to allow trucks to park on Wellington Street came under heavy criticism.
